This script starts a noninteractive job on a single batch node in the cheyenne regular queue. Altair launches pbs pro june 23, 2015 by staff today altair announced the general availability of pbs professional. Pbs professional pbs pro the version of pbs offered by altair engineering that is dual licensed under an. Pbspro or portable batch system professional is a distributed workload management software that provides a unified batch queuing and job management interface to a set of computing resources. External reference specification vii preface intended audience this document provides a computer programmer with the information required to write an application using the portable batch system pbs external api. Pbs is responsible for resource management, job scheduling, supercomputer optimization. Submit a batch job to request a gpu node using the correct queue. Pbs pro continues to be enhanced to take advantage of new computing platforms and grid technologies.
Comparative study of distributed resource management. Pbs pro job script examples computational information. It fits a wide range of business needs, and allows your accounting software to grow with. Pbs professional is the enhanced commercial version of the pbs software originally developed for nasa. Portable batch system pbs is the name of computer software that. For example, if it sees the same message going to the same receiver on the same communicator and tag, it can just tick off a counter and say send n of this same message, and then only actually send that message and. With pbs express, you may view job details on clusters view cluster status and queue availability autonotification of completed. With over 30 years of industry leadership, altair is your expert highperformance computing solution partner.
For running resourceintensive tasks such as cesm and wrf builds or other compiles with three or more threads, cisl provides qcmd. Pbs professional oss integration azure cyclecloud microsoft docs. This doesnt sound too difficult, but what does it mean exactly. The two basic components of a pbs professional cluster are the master node which provides a shared filesystem on which the pbs professional software runs, and the. Ames research center was a commonly used batchqueuing system.
They may be used to hold and pass messages in an operating system, within an application, or between computer systems. Oct 07, 2017 learn to use pbs pro job scheduler hpc systems portable batch system pbs is the name of computer software that performs job scheduling. Mpi job script openmp job script hybrid job script job array command file job pinning tasksthreads to cpus dependent jobs. Cf present in the root folder of kubernetespbsproconnector. Pbs accounting is a robust, professional level accounting system that can help you grow your business. To submit a batch job to the specified queue using a script. Our software allows your business to optimize the process for customers as they line up and wait for their turn to be served, enhancing your level of customer service. Yet it would print a lot of extra info that may or may not be useful. Queuerite is a complete software system for customer queue management system. Its primary task is to allocate computational tasks, i. Proxmox server solutions complete actively developed opensource agplv3 linux, windows, other operating systems are known to work and are community supported free yes. Learn to use pbs pro job scheduler learn scientific programming.
Built by hpc people for hpc people, pbs professional is fast, scalable, secure, and resilient, and supports all modern. The nasa version had a number of corporate and individual contributors over the years, for which the pbs developers and pbs community are most grateful. Together, the tightly integrated software provides a seamless solution for provisioning, scheduling, monitoring and managing hpc clusters, both onpremise and in the cloud. List of top message queue software 2020 trustradius. Portable batch system pbs is a software which is used in cluster computing to schedule jobs on multiple nodes. Pbs pro job script examples computational information systems.
Pbs consists of a set of commands and system daemonsservices, shown here. Jobs for which the user does not have status privilege are not displayed. Qline is our web based queue management software solution that not only gives you the means to bring your customer flow management to the next level, but also delivers it in a way that is easy to use and even easier to maintain, thanks to the cloud. Adding and removing nodes to a specific queue for pbspro. Pbs professional is a highly scaleable and open workload management solution that maximizes the utilization of highperformance computing resources. Quick tutorial for portable batch system pbs the portable batch system pbs system is designed to manage the distribution of batch jobs and interactive sessions across the available nodes in the cluster. Submitting jobs with pbs computational information. This edition pertains to pbs pro fessional in general, with specific information for version 9. Altair pbs professional, an intelligent workload management and batch queuing solution for numerically intense compute environments, is the flagship product of altairs enterprise business unit. The researchers use several 64bit workstations with advanced graphics configurations for pre and postprocessing models. Pbs is supported as a job scheduler mechanism by several meta.
Pbs is available in three different versions as below. Pbs professional is the enhanced commercial version of the pbs software originally devel oped for nasa. Pbs professional oss scheduler configuration in azure cyclecloud. No need to install software or hardware at agent counters.
The four most commonly used pbs commands, qsub, qstat, qdel, and qhold, are briefly described below. Portable batch system or simply pbs is the name of computer software that performs job. Modify your pbs script to run startx and set display to. When you use any of these examples, remember to substitute your own job name and project code, and customize the other directives and commands as necessary. Pbs pro has changed the syntax for this type of selection. Bright cluster manager offers pbs professional as a preconfigured, system administratorselectable option. When submitting a job to the queue with qsub you can specify options either within your script, or as command line options. Pbspro or portable batch system professional is a distributed workload management software that provides a unified batch queuing and job management. Queue names on pleiades include normal, debug, long, devel, and low. Pbs pro software using pbs training classes pbs administration training classes pbs internals training classes annual technical support installation assistance upgrade assistance customization system analysis needs assessment pbs pro. Nasa modeling guru home top of page this site powered by jive sbs 4. Dec 05, 2018 the four most commonly used pbs commands, qsub, qstat, qdel, and qhold, are briefly described below.
When requesting queue status, synopsis format 2, qstat will output information about each destination. This web page provides an introduction to basic pbs usage. How to run a graphics application in a pbs batch job. Altair job scheduler actively developed masterworker distributed with failover hpchtc agpl or proprietary linux, windows free or cost yes proxmox virtual environment. Using the pbs queue division of information technology. About altair pbs works global leader in hpc workload. A queue management system qms is a set of tools developed to manage and analyze the flow of visitors. About altair pbs works global leader in hpc workload management. Pbs professional software optimizes job scheduling and workload management in highperformance computing hpc environments clusters, clouds, and supercomputers improving system efficiency and peoples productivity. The nasa version had a number of corporate and individual contributors. Pbs is a workload management system from veridian that provides a unified batch queuing and job management interface to a set of computing resources. If a node has been associated to a queue, ptl wont unassociate it when it is trying to revert to defaults. Extensive information about pbs pro can be found in the pbs pro users guide.
The pbs professional documentation the documentation for pbs professional includes the following. You can get the various queues available and corresponding resource limits of the cluster you use by typing qstat qf in terminal. In the rest of this report, some widelydeployed drms. Any serverlevel or queuelevel jobwide builtin or custom resource, whether it is numeric, string, or boolean, for example ncpus and software. See our short demo video for an overview on the queuerite customer queue management software. Portable batch system or simply pbs is the name of computer software that performs job scheduling. This document provides the user with the information required to use the portable batch system.
Pbs matches the requirements of each of your tasks to the right hardware, licenses, and time slot, and makes sure that tasks are run accord ing to the sites policy. We chose altair thanks to pbs professionals rich set of queuing, managing, and reporting capabilities and the companys. Joseph swartz, program chief scientist at lockheed martin. Only required for jobs using specific software packages with limited numbers of licenses.
The fairshare ensures that individual users may consume approximately equal amount of resources. Paul tuesday, may 19, as they wait their turn at a state drivers license exam station, which opened for the first time afte a twomonth coronavirus. Jun 29, 2007 nasa modeling guru home top of page this site powered by jive sbs 4. Pbs professional software optimizes job scheduling and workload management in highperformance computing hpc environments clusters, clouds, and.
Best message queue software 6 a message queue is a component that facilitates information exchange between processors, effectively holding messages until they are processed by some component service in a system. Consequently, ames then led an effort to develop requirements and specifications for a newer, cluster. The definitive guide to queue management systems qminder. Pbs professional offers powerful, policybased and topology aware scheduling, millioncore scalability, and other capabilities for easily managing any hpc system from small departmental. Flexible solution capable of addressing any business requirement and all types of customer service. We chose altair thanks to pbs professional s rich set of queuing, managing, and reporting capabilities and the companys willingness to innovate with us. Mpi libraries are available for mpp lsdyna parallel runs as well as pbs pro queuing system. A batch script is simply a small text file that can be created with a text editor such as vi or notepad. Mar 27, 20 download queueing theory software for calc for free. The pbs module should be loaded automatically for you at login, allowing you access to the pbs commands. Pbs professional red hat certified software red hat.
Server failing to recover queue on restart and having. It is often used in conjunction with unix cluster environments. Before the emergence of clusters, the unixbased network queuing system nqs from nasa ames research center was a commonly used batch queuing system. The scheduler chooses where and when to run the jobs, and the server sends the jobs to mom. Pbs professional is a trusted solution for automating job scheduling, management, monitoring, and reporting. Mar 17, 2003 the product intelligently queues and schedules computation workload across complex networks to optimize hardware and software utilization while minimizing job turnaround times. This software can be grossly separated in four categories. Queue management system queuerite online cloud based. The nasa version had a number of corporate and individual contributors over the years, for which the pbs developers and pbs community is most grateful. Pbs professional is the professional workload management system from altair that provides a unified queuing and job management interface to a set of computing resources. Pbspro supercomputer education and research centre. Pbs is a workload management system that provides a unified batch queuing and job man agement interface to a set of computing resources.
It is often used in conjunction with unix cluster environments pbs is supported as a job scheduler mechanism by several meta schedulers including moab by adaptive computing. The hyperworks unlimited virtual appliance is a cae cloud solution, bringing. This edition pertains to pbs professional in general, with. In this video from sc15, sam mahalingam from altair discusses a pair of important announcements from the company.
At afrl, we use the pbs professional queuing system. It will ask for the execution directory where you want to store the executable such as qsub, pbsnodes, qdel etc. Windows has its own version of job scheduling software in the microsoft hpc pack. Jobsubmission queues and charges calculating charges checking and managing charges most cheyenne batch queues are for exclusive use, so jobs submitted to those queues are charged for all 36 cores on each node that is used. If no operand is specified, all jobs at the default destination, see the pbs ers section, the default server. Ideally, a queue management system exists to prevent the formation of queues altogether, though its use is not limited to queue managing. Hardware independence install any kiosk, display, audio equipment and so forth. To submit a batch job to the cheyenne queues, use the qsub command followed by the name of your pbs batch script file. Job scheduler, nodes management, nodes installation and integrated stack all the above. This answer is not applicable to pbs pro v10 or v11. On the other hand the p s command would print all queues associated with all servers since no active server is set.
Then with the emergence of parallel distributed system, nqs began to show its limitations. Jobsubmission queues and charges computational information. Pbs portable batch system pro provides a graphical interface for submitting both batch and interactive jobs, querying job, queue, and system status, and tracking the progress of jobs. The following tables compare general and technical information for notable computer cluster software. In most cases this would print no active queues, nothing done. Learn to use pbs pro job scheduler learn scientific. We focus on the technology so you can work on what really matters solving real engineering challenges. Altair pbs professional is a fast, powerful workload manager designed to improve productivity, optimize utilization and efficiency, and simplify administration for. Pbs is a workload management system that provides a unified batch queuing and job management interface to a set of computing resources. Qnomys visit management app enables mobile phone checkin, queuing and callforward notifications. Pbs professional 12 administrators guide ix about pbs documentation where to keep the documentation to make crossreferences work, put all of the pbs guides in the same directory. Usage of the software and other information provided by altair. Im only getting familiar with it myself so dont want to try to do it justice here. This document provides the user with the information required to use the portable batch system pbs, including creating, submitting, and manipulating batch jobs.
1386 1254 1198 723 18 1639 1595 728 1173 172 854 537 13 408 303 769 806 344 282 7 1353 1631 983 359 1534 870 667 890 1052 644 19 1087 1023 841 1002 1252 1374 749 729